It is the basic supply v demand, same with pretty much everything in this hobby.

For UK collectors there is the obvious nostalgia

For others there is the rarity attraction or that they are different to the more available Kenner and represent a new line to start.

They are on a major high at the moment. At other times they haven't been

Here's the complete cardback run from SW through to trilogo

completelukex-wing.jpg


45a was the last of the logo. That is generally what makes them so sought after.

While rarer than Kenner in most cases, they are not all as rare as people think, just very highly sort after so hit high prices when they surface on eBay. But loads sell behind the scenes, again often for high prices
